St. Patrick’s Day Green Fruit Salad Recipe

  • Total Time: 15 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Celebrate St. Patrick’s Day with this vibrant and refreshing Green Fruit Salad featuring juicy green grapes, tangy kiwi, and crisp green apples tossed in zesty lime juice and fresh mint. A light drizzle of honey adds a touch of natural sweetness, making it a perfect healthy dish for springtime gatherings or a festive snack.


Ingredients

Fruits

  • 1 cup green grapes, washed and halved
  • 2 kiwis, peeled and sliced into bite-sized pieces
  • 2 green apples, cored and chopped into bite-sized pieces

Other Ingredients

  • 2 tablespoons fresh lime juice
  • 10 fresh mint leaves, roughly chopped
  • 1 tablespoon honey (optional)

Instructions

  1. Wash the fruit: Rinse the green grapes, kiwis, and green apples thoroughly under cold running water to ensure they are clean and fresh.
  2. Prepare the fruit: Slice the kiwis and green apples into bite-sized chunks. Halve the grapes to match the size of the other fruits for easy eating.
  3. Add lime juice: Squeeze fresh lime juice evenly over the chopped fruit pieces to prevent the apples from browning and to add a zesty flavor.
  4. Toss with mint: Place all the fruit in a large mixing bowl, add the roughly chopped mint leaves, and gently toss everything together until the mint is evenly distributed and the fruit is well coated.
  5. Add honey (optional): Drizzle honey over the salad if you prefer additional sweetness, then give the salad one last gentle toss before serving.

Notes

  • Use ripe but firm fruits to maintain texture and prevent mushiness.
  • Lime juice helps keep the apples from turning brown and brightens the flavors.
  • Honey is optional and can be adjusted or omitted based on your preference for sweetness.
  • For a fun twist, try adding sliced green pears or a handful of chopped pistachios for crunch.
  • This salad is best served chilled; refrigerate for 15 minutes before serving if time allows.
